Peter Andre (born 27 February 1973) is an English-born Cypriot-Australian singer, songwriter, businessman, and television personality. He gained popularity as a singer, best known for his singles "Mysterious Girl" and "Flava".
He is also known for appearing on the third series of I'm a Celebrity...Get Me Out of Here!, and the thirteenth series of Strictly Come Dancing, in which he was partnered with Janette Manrara.
While it might seem like you know Peter Andre's life pretty well, from his Mysterious Girl days to his stint in the Australian jungle, the star is ready to set the record straight.
In his column with new magazine this week, the 50-year-old revealed that he's not only in 'talks' to make a movie about his life but he's actually in the planning stages already.
He said: "I’m currently in talks for a very exciting project to create a movie about my life. It’s going to be epic. Of course, it will take up to two years to finish, but I’m very excited about the whole process. "Although many people may feel they know a lot, many don’t know the real story of my life.There’s a lot to tell.
